How to Size a Mist Separator for Your Space
Selecting the right size for a mist separator starts with calculating the total volume of the growing area in cubic feet. A general rule for indoor farming is to aim for a minimum of 15 to 20 air changes per hour to prevent humidity and mist buildup. To find the required Cubic Feet per Minute (CFM) rating, multiply the room’s volume by the desired air changes and then divide by 60.
Consider the density of the misting system and the proximity of the unit to the source. If the farm uses high-pressure aeroponics that create a constant, thick fog, a unit with a higher CFM than the base calculation is advisable. Conversely, a farm using low-pressure drip systems with only occasional misting can afford to stay closer to the minimum requirements.
Static pressure is the final piece of the sizing puzzle, especially if ductwork is involved. Every foot of hose and every bend in the ducting creates resistance that the separator’s motor must overcome. Always check the manufacturer’s fan curve to ensure the unit can still move the necessary volume of air once it is fully connected to the system’s infrastructure.
Routine Maintenance Tips for Peak Performance
A mist separator is only as effective as its cleaning schedule allows it to be. The primary task is the regular inspection of the drainage lines to ensure that collected liquid is flowing freely back to the reservoir or waste container. If these lines become kinked or clogged with nutrient salts, the liquid will back up into the filter housing, potentially damaging the motor or leaking onto the floor.
Vibration is often the first sign that a centrifugal drum needs attention. Over time, uneven buildup of nutrient residues can throw the drum out of balance, leading to excessive noise and bearing wear. Wiping down the internal surfaces of the drum every few months prevents this imbalance and extends the life of the machine significantly.
- Check drainage hoses for salt buildup or kinks weekly.
- Inspect pre-filters every 30 days and wash or replace as needed.
- Listen for changes in motor pitch or increased vibration during daily rounds.
- Verify that all seals and gaskets remain airtight to prevent bypass air.
Why Clean Air Matters in Vertical Agriculture
In a vertical farm, the air is the medium through which plants breathe and transpire. When oil mist or nutrient aerosols linger in the air, they settle on the leaves and can physically block the stomata—the small pores responsible for gas exchange. This blockage stunts growth, reduces yields, and makes the plants more susceptible to disease by creating a sticky surface where pathogens can thrive.
Beyond plant health, the longevity of the farm’s hardware depends on air quality. LED grow lights are significant investments, and their cooling fins and lenses are magnets for airborne mist. Once a film develops, it acts as an insulator that causes the lights to run hotter and dim over time, leading to premature failure and decreased light penetration for the crops below.
Finally, the health of the farmer must be the top priority in any indoor operation. Inhaling concentrated nutrient mists or machine oils over long periods can lead to respiratory irritation or more serious long-term health issues. A high-quality mist separator isn’t just a tool for the plants; it is a critical piece of safety equipment that ensures the hobby remains a healthy and rewarding pursuit.
